Automated Crack Recognition System (ACRS)
Overview
C-Map Systems Automated Crack Recognition System classifies distress on traveled surfaces in real time. The system can be used with customer source code to report pavement surface distress based on customer detection algorithms. The system supports two cameras such that image analysis may be performed with either the front vehicle mounted camera, or the rear mounted camera. The ACRS system performs well in low light situations. Artificial lighting is not required.
Hardware
Enclosure
Rack mount enclosure
Standard 19 inch enclosure with 110 volt AC power input.
Supports dual acquisition system.
Camera
2048 element linear pixel array
Responsivity greater than 12V/uJ/cm^2
Line scan rate better than 29 kilohertz
Camera operates at stated scan rate at light level
Operating temperature 30 to 110 degrees Fahrenheit
Camera does not use TDI technology
Lens mount – standard “F” lens mount
LVDS interface supplied with 5 meter cable
Standard12 volt power supply
Frame Grabber
Interfaces with camera (above)
Software support for Windows
Software support for Linux
Image size 2048x1024 (minimum)
Acquisition rate at (at 2048x1024) 60 megabits per second
Image Analysis Module
Supports dual gigabit Ethernet for transfer of raw images over network.
Supports storage of raw images to local hard disk.
Module analyzes images in real time, utilizing source code compiled, installed and run on the image analysis module.
System fault tolerant to loss of power (survive power loss without corrupting the operating system or data)
Software support for Windows
Software support for Linux
Miscellaneous
All LVDS cables, power cables, power supplies, etc. included with system.
Documentation for cameras, frame grabber and analysis module are provided with system.
Drivers supporting Linux and Windows are provided with system.
Entire system is ruggedized to withstand temperature, humidity and vibration environment of collection vehicle.
